Wireless Connectivity Click Boards

Mikroe Wireless Connectivity Click Boards add wireless communication interfaces into designs. Mikroe Click Boards are based around the mikroBUS™ interface standard and easily add incredible capabilities to systems. MIKROE-3294 NB IoT Click

Mikroe MIKROE-3294 NB IoT Click allows LTE Cat NB1 connectivity by utilizing Quectel BC95-G multi-band IoT module. The Mikroe BC95-G module requires very low power and incorporates a compact form factor, making it ideal for various IoT-based applications. The NB IoT click board also features FT230X USB to UART IC from FTDI Chip and TXB0106 6-bit bidirectional level shifter from Texas Instruments. This click board also offers embedded communication stacks, multi-band NB technology support, SMA antenna connector, USB to UART connectivity, and network status indication.
